We just took it deep, says Jitesh Sharma

"We have a strong belief system. We have match winners. Look at our playing XI, and we have match winners,” Jitesh Sharma said

HYDERABAD: Jitesh Sharma of Royal Challengers Bengaluru, who scored a match-winning 33-ball, 85 against Lucknow Super Giants in the last IPL league match in Lucknow on Tuesday, said he would not be able to express his thoughts.

“I can’t believe I played that knock. When Virat bhai was out, I was just thinking of taking it deep. As my mentor and guru Dinesh [Karthik] anna says, just take it deep,” Jitesh said in a chat with the host broadcaster.


“I was getting cramps because the entire load was on me! I have Virat bhai, Krunal bhai and Bhuvi bhai with me. I feel excited that I’m playing with them. We want to enjoy the moment,” said the ‘player of the match’.

“But we’ll try to recover well. We’ll look to carry the momentum into the next match. Credit goes to Rajat. I had the responsibility of maintaining his record. Hazlewood will perhaps play in the knockout,” Jitesh said.

“We have a strong belief system. We have match winners. Look at our playing XI, and we have match winners,” he said.

And for his part, Mayank Agarwal, who also contributed with a crucial 23-ball, 41 in RCB’s win, said there was very little to do. “I just had to give him the strike. Jitesh just put on a show. There are no words to describe what he did. We were just calculating,” he said.

“We knew Digvesh had one over. So we were like, if we could get 10 off him. The wicket was good to target the fast bowlers,” Mayank said.

“Jitesh just did what he had to. It builds a lot of confidence and momentum… we couldn’t do it last game. When I came in, we had lost two quick wickets,” he said.

“It was good that Virat and I could get quick runs going at that time. Then it was about one batsman batting through. I’m glad we took them down,” he said.
